Cozy Comforts Basket

When creating an elderly gift basket focused on cozy comforts, include warm blankets and a tea assortment to provide a sense of warmth and relaxation.

Start by selecting soft blankets that are gentle on the skin and offer comfort during chilly evenings. Opt for ones that are easy to cuddle up with while watching a favorite movie or reading a good book.

Pair these cozy blankets with a variety of soothing teas to create a tranquil experience. Choose an assortment of herbal teas like chamomile or peppermint known for their calming properties. These teas can help promote relaxation and provide a moment of tranquility for the recipient.

Healthy Treats Basket

To further support your elderly loved one’s well-being, consider creating a Healthy Treats Basket filled with nourishing snacks and goodies. This thoughtful gift will bring joy and promote good health and self-care.

Here are some ideas for the basket:

  • Nutritious Snacks: Include a variety of healthy snacks like mixed nuts, dried fruits, whole grain crackers, or granola bars. These options provide essential nutrients and energy for daily intake.
  • Hydration Helpers: Add herbal teas, flavored water enhancers, or electrolyte packets to encourage proper hydration, which is crucial for overall well-being, especially in the elderly.
  • Self-Care Essentials: Include items like dark chocolate (in moderation), herbal honey sticks, or antioxidant-rich trail mix. These treats not only taste good but also offer health benefits that support self-care practices.

Brain Games and Puzzles Collection

To keep your elderly parents’ minds engaged and provide them with enjoyable mental stimulation, introduce a diverse collection of brain games and puzzles. These activities not only provide cognitive stimulation but also help sharpen the mind.

Here are some options to consider:

  1. Sudoku Puzzle Book: A classic brain teaser available in various difficulty levels to keep your parents entertained and their minds active.
  2. Jigsaw Puzzles: Choose puzzles with beautiful landscapes or nostalgic themes to provide a relaxing yet mentally stimulating activity.
  3. Crossword Puzzle Set: Crossword puzzles are great for enhancing vocabulary and memory while offering an enjoyable challenge.
  4. Memory Card Game: A fun way to boost memory skills and cognitive function, memory card games can be played alone or with a partner for added social interaction.

Including these brain games and puzzles in your gift basket can provide hours of entertainment and mental exercise for your elderly parents.

Memory Lane Basket

Create a thoughtful memory lane basket for an elderly loved one by curating nostalgic items that evoke cherished memories. Take them on a sentimental journey down memory lane with carefully selected treasures that will warm their heart.

Ideas for a Memory Lane Basket:

  • Personalized Photo Album: Fill it with pictures from their past, capturing special moments and loved ones.
  • Favorite Childhood Treats: Include candies or snacks they enjoyed in their youth for a sweet trip down memory lane.
  • Classic Movies or Music: Select films or songs from their era to bring back fond memories and create a cozy atmosphere.
  • Vintage Keepsakes: Add items like a retro clock, old-fashioned ornaments, or a vintage trinket box to evoke the essence of days gone by.

How do you make an impressive gift basket? ›

Arrange the tallest or largest items at the back of the container to create a visual balance. Gradually fill in the space with smaller items, ensuring everything is visible and aesthetically pleasing. Pay attention to color and texture, and arrange items in an eye-catching manner.

How do you present a gift basket? ›

Wrap It in Cellophane

Once you know the size, make the cut. Wrap the cellophane around the basket, scrunching it up in the center at the top of the basket, then secure it with a twist tie. Finally, take a roll of festive ribbon and tie a bow around the twist-tie-secured cellophane.
